Shake Shack shares rise on 1Q results ahead of Wall Street expectations

Shake Shack (NYSE:SHAK) beat Wall Street's expectations with its latest quarterly results, sending its stock up over 11% in response.

The burger chain reported a smaller-than-expected loss for the first quarter of 2023, while its revenue and same-restaurant sales also exceeded Wall Street forecasts.

Shake Shack (NYSE:SHAK)’s total revenue was $253.3 million, an increase of 24.5% compared to the same period last year. Operating loss was $3.2 million, with shack-level operating profit (defined as Shack sales less Shack-level operating expenses including food and paper costs, labor and related expenses) at $44.7 million or 18.3% of shack sales.

Shake Shack (NYSE:SHAK)'s loss per share was $0.01, beating the expected $0.08 loss per share. Revenues of $253.3 million beat analysts' consensus of $245.7 million.

During the quarter, the company opened six new domestic Shacks and seven new licensed Shacks, including locations in Mexico and China.
